Compartilhar via


ShareOperation.ReportCompleted Método

Definição

Sobrecargas

ReportCompleted()

Especifica que a operação de compartilhamento está concluída.

ReportCompleted(QuickLink)

Especifica que a operação de compartilhamento está concluída. Um QuickLink que o sistema pode salvar como um atalho para futuras operações de compartilhamento está incluído.

ReportCompleted()

Especifica que a operação de compartilhamento está concluída.

public:
 virtual void ReportCompleted() = ReportCompleted;
/// [Windows.Foundation.Metadata.Overload("ReportCompleted")]
void ReportCompleted();
[Windows.Foundation.Metadata.Overload("ReportCompleted")]
public void ReportCompleted();
function reportCompleted()
Public Sub ReportCompleted ()
Atributos

Exemplos

O exemplo a seguir mostra como um aplicativo de destino pode responder a uma operação de compartilhamento. Observe o uso de reportComplete quando o aplicativo de destino terminar de processar os dados.

if (eventArgs.kind === Windows.ApplicationModel.Activation.ActivationKind.shareTarget) {
    shareOperation = eventArgs.shareOperation;
    if (shareOperation.data.contains(Windows.ApplicationModel.DataTransfer.StandardDataFormats.text)) {
        var output = document.createElement("div");
        var shareData = shareOperation.data.getText();
        output.innerText = shareData;
        document.body.appendChild(output);
        shareOperation.reportCompleted();
    }
}

Comentários

Quando seu aplicativo atua como um destino para uma operação de compartilhamento, ele deve chamar reportComplete depois de processar os dados que estão sendo compartilhados. Esse método fecha a janela do aplicativo e retorna o usuário para o aplicativo de origem.

Confira também

Aplica-se a

ReportCompleted(QuickLink)

Especifica que a operação de compartilhamento está concluída. Um QuickLink que o sistema pode salvar como um atalho para futuras operações de compartilhamento está incluído.

public:
 virtual void ReportCompleted(QuickLink ^ quicklink) = ReportCompleted;
/// [Windows.Foundation.Metadata.Overload("ReportCompletedWithQuickLink")]
void ReportCompleted(QuickLink const& quicklink);
[Windows.Foundation.Metadata.Overload("ReportCompletedWithQuickLink")]
public void ReportCompleted(QuickLink quicklink);
function reportCompleted(quicklink)
Public Sub ReportCompleted (quicklink As QuickLink)

Parâmetros

quicklink
QuickLink

Um objeto QuickLink que o sistema salva como um atalho para futuras operações de compartilhamento.

Atributos

Confira também

Aplica-se a